Discover why Copart (CPRT) stands out in vehicle auctions with strong growth, global expansion, and solid returns.
It is an animal menagerie when it comes to China’s tech scene, from little dragons to AI tigers. For the uninitiated, the most familiar name will likely be the “BATs”, Baidu, Alibaba and Tencent.
To be completely fair, Goddard’s footprint did need modernization. The campus master plan—begun years ago—imagined a 20-year cycle of demolitions, renovations, and new builds. The idea: retire the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results